¿Qué significa esto?
In this verse, Naaman is upset because he expected the prophet Elisha to perform a special healing ceremony for him, but Elisha just sent a message to wash in the Jordan River. Naaman is angry because he thought Elisha would do more to heal his leprosy.

Contexto histórico
The Book of 2 Kings was likely written by prophets or scribes around 550 BC. It describes the kings of Israel and Judah, including stories like Naaman's, which illustrates the power of faith and obedience to God's instructions.
